Head of Facilities

Barts Health NHS Trust runs one of the largest estates in the NHS, supporting some of the busiest and most complex hospitals in the country. With a strong group model and senior leadership embedded at each site, we’re focused on safe, effective, high-quality environments that enable outstanding care across East London.

We’re now seeking to recruit four Head of Facilities (Band 8C) roles to join us at a pivotal time. This is a senior leadership role with real scope — overseeing a wide range of Soft FM services at your base hospital while supporting delivery across the wider group. From cleaning and catering to waste, linen, reception and security, you’ll be responsible for services that are vital to safety, experience and wellbeing. This is also a transformational role aimed at delivering more with less — driving innovation, unlocking efficiencies and reshaping services for the future.

Responsibilities

* Lead the delivery of Soft FM services and project programmes across your hospital site, including clinical service-led and mobilisation projects. Provide operational leadership to site-based service managers and teams, ensuring consistent performance management, workforce support, and delivery against Trust standards.
* Manage external contractors, consultants and suppliers, ensuring delivery is aligned with Trust values, policies, and compliance frameworks. Hold delegated responsibility for operational and capital budgets, procurement activity, and invoice approvals.
* Work closely with Estates & Facilities Directors, Soft FM Associate Directors and site leads to ensure services meet KPI outcomes, PAM targets, and compliance with national standards including CQC. Ensure service models support safe, patient-focused care without compromising clinical delivery.
* Provide strategic input into EFM service planning, digital transformation, and Trust-wide project delivery. Represent Soft FM at senior forums, act as a key escalation point, and deputise for the Director of Soft FM where required.
* Lead risk management, incident investigations, and Datix reporting for Soft FM. Champion workforce development through training, recruitment, and staff engagement. Maintain a senior leadership presence via a 7-day operational rota to ensure robust site support.
